How to Edit Your Google Business Profile in 2026

Your Google Business Profile is often the first thing customers see when they search for your business. Keeping it accurate and up to date directly affects whether they call, visit, or move on to a rival.

How to Access Your Profile

Accessing and Basic Google Business Profile Edit

Option 1: Google Search Search your exact business name on Google while signed into your management account. Your Business Profile panel appears on the right side. Click "Edit profile" to make changes directly. Option 2: Google Business Profile Manager Go to business.google.com, select your business, and edit from the dashboard. This method gives you access to all settings, including those not visible in the search panel. Option 3: Google Maps Search for your business on Google Maps, click your listing, and select "Edit" or "Suggest an edit" (if signed into the management account, you'll see full edit controls).

What You Can Edit

  • Business name — must match your real-world signage and legal name
  • Address — update if you've moved; hide it if you're a service-area business
  • Phone number — use a local number for better local SEO
  • Website URL — link to your homepage or a specific landing page
  • Business hours — include special hours for holidays
  • Business category — your primary category is the most important local ranking factor
  • Description — up to 750 characters to describe what you offer
  • Photos — add new images of your storefront, products, team, and interior
  • Services/Products — list your offerings with descriptions and prices
  • Attributes — accessibility features, payment methods, amenities

Changes That Need Verification

Most edits go live within minutes. However, certain changes may trigger re-check: Business name changes — Google may require proof that the new name is real Address changes — moving to a new location often requires a new check postcard Category changes — major category shifts may need review

Frequently Asked Questions

How long do Google Business Profile edits take to appear?

Most edits appear within minutes to a few hours. Name changes, address changes, and category changes may take longer as Google reviews them for accuracy. In rare cases, edits may take up to 3 days.

Can anyone edit my Google Business Profile?

Anyone can "suggest an edit" to any business on Google Maps, but suggestions go through Google's review process. Only verified owners and managers can make direct edits. If you notice unauthorized changes, review your profile regularly and revert incorrect data.

Should I edit my business description for SEO?

Yes, but write for humans first. Include your main services, your location, and what differentiates you. Avoid keyword stuffing — Google's guidelines explicitly prohibit it and may penalize your listing.
